Output 94ba6589160b0f91dffaee7b825464c118128b973fd4bedb5d56c6e84fa0822f:0

value
169077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685f20e1b7baaf65ec578a89a2442101ae51f82e OP_EQUAL
address
3BCtA8k1yu1Ke7A2R83mHLHoD7PmXgFgbS
transaction
94ba6589160b0f91dffaee7b825464c118128b973fd4bedb5d56c6e84fa0822f
spent
true